Division No. 19 is a census division in Alberta, Canada. It is located in the west-central portion of northern Alberta and surrounds the City of Grande Prairie.

Demographics

In the 2011 Census, Division No. 19 had a population of 109,712 living in 41,399 of its 44,851 total dwellings, an 11.1% change from its 2006 population of 98,712. With a land area of 20,520 km2 (7,920 sq mi), it had a population density of 5.3 people per square kilometre in 2011.[1]

In 2006, Division No. 19 had a population of 98,712 living in 37,685 dwellings, a 14.4% increase from 2001. The census division has a land area of 20,518.15 km2 (7,922.10 sq mi) and a population density of 4.8 inhabitants per square kilometre.[4]
